Dear Tumblr staff,
Firstly, let us tell you how much we heart Tumblr. It has become a part of our lives, a truly amazing way to express ourselves, our tastes, our feelings. We are fond of all the new features you incorporate to make Tumblr more innovative and easier to use. All, that is, except for one. Tumblarity has become that part of Tumblr we are not really fond of, to put it lightly.
OK, we cannot lie to you. We hate its guts.
We don't really see any reason for its existence, other than making us feel bad about the things we post. And even though we try not to pay attention to it, it's right there, going up and down like the yo-yo effect. After weeks and weeks of using it, most of us still cannot comprehend how it works exactly, and why it can suddenly drop 40% overnight.
Truth be told, as much as we appreciate the need for innovation and your great efforts, the tumblarity feature is taking away the fun that is Tumblr to us.
So please, fix it, or get rid of it, or make it optional.
Thank you.
You rock.
